What are the reasons behind high school outcast stories?
1 answer
2024-10-28 18:34
Often, social status is a big factor. In high school, there are these unwritten hierarchies. The popular kids at the top might exclude those who don't fit their idea of cool. Economic differences can also be a reason. If a student can't afford the latest gadgets or trendy clothes, they might be made fun of and become an outcast. And then there are those who are just different in terms of personality, like being overly intense or too laid - back for the general school crowd.
